5KP85A-E3/54 Product Overview
Introduction
The 5KP85A-E3/54 is a high-performance transient voltage suppressor diode designed to protect sensitive electronic equipment from voltage transients induced by lightning and other transient voltage events. Product Category
The 5KP85A-E3/54 belongs to the category of transient voltage suppressor diodes, which are widely used in various electronic systems to protect against voltage spikes and surges.
Basic Information Overview
- Use: The 5KP85A-E3/54 is used to protect sensitive electronic components and circuits from overvoltage transients.
- Characteristics: It offers high surge capability, low clamping voltage, and fast response time.
- Package: The device is available in a DO-201AD package.
- Essence: Its essence lies in providing robust protection against transient voltage events.
- Packaging/Quantity: The 5KP85A-E3/54 is typically packaged in reels or tubes, with quantities varying based on customer requirements.
Specifications
- Peak Pulse Power: 5000 W
- Breakdown Voltage: 85 V
- Operating Temperature Range: -55°C to +175°C
- Reverse Standoff Voltage: 85 V
- Forward Voltage: 3.5 V at 100 A
- Reverse Leakage Current: 1 µA
Detailed Pin Configuration
The 5KP85A-E3/54 features a standard DO-201AD package with two leads. The anode is connected to one lead, while the cathode is connected to the other lead.
Functional Features
- Transient Voltage Suppression: Effectively clamps transient voltages to safe levels.
- Fast Response Time: Rapid reaction to transient events ensures minimal impact on protected circuits.
- High Surge Capability: Capable of withstanding high surge currents without degradation.
Advantages and Disadvantages
Advantages
- Robust protection against voltage transients
- Low clamping voltage
- High surge capability
Disadvantages
- Higher cost compared to traditional diodes
- Requires careful consideration of mounting and layout for optimal performance
Working Principles
When a transient voltage event occurs, the 5KP85A-E3/54 conducts and clamps the voltage to a safe level, diverting the excess energy away from the protected circuit.

What is the maximum peak pulse power dissipation of 5KP85A-E3/54?
- The maximum peak pulse power dissipation is 5000 watts for a 10/1000 μs waveform.
What is the breakdown voltage of 5KP85A-E3/54?
- The breakdown voltage is 85 volts.
What is the typical clamping voltage of 5KP85A-E3/54?
- The typical clamping voltage is 137 volts at 14 A.
What is the operating temperature range of 5KP85A-E3/54?
- The operating temperature range is -55°C to +175°C.
What is the peak pulse current capability of 5KP85A-E3/54?
- The peak pulse current capability is 195.2 A for an 8/20 μs waveform.
What is the package type of 5KP85A-E3/54?
- The package type is DO-201AD (DO-27).
Is 5KP85A-E3/54 RoHS compliant?
- Yes, it is RoHS compliant.
What are the typical applications of 5KP85A-E3/54?
- Typical applications include transient voltage suppression in industrial and telecommunication equipment, as well as surge protection in consumer electronics.
Does 5KP85A-E3/54 have a low leakage current?
- Yes, it has a low leakage current of less than 1 μA at its rated voltage.
What is the lead-free status of 5KP85A-E3/54?
- It is lead-free and meets the requirements of the European Union's Restriction of Hazardous Substances (RoHS) directive.
